Is ground beef a good source of protein?

Is ground beef a good source of protein?

90% (or Leaner) Ground Beef Lean ground beef is a source of high-quality protein, and you don’t need a lot to get the protein you need. Just 3 ounces delivers 22 grams of protein, along with a healthy dose of iron, zinc and vitamin B12.

Is ground beef OK to eat everyday?

Regular consumption of ground beef may affect your joints and kidneys. Whenever you eat animal protein, especially red meat, your uric acid levels can rise. Uric acid buildup in the bloodstream can cause crystals to form in the joints (gout) and combine into uric stones in the kidneys. Both are extremely painful.

Why you should not eat ground beef?

Spoiled ground beef is dangerous to eat because it may contain pathogenic bacteria, which are responsible for foodborne illnesses. Symptoms include fever, vomiting, stomach cramps, and diarrhea which may be bloody ( 9 , 10 , 11 ).

Why is beef the best protein?

Lean red meat is one of the best protein sources that we can eat, containing roughly 23-28g per 4 ounce serving. The protein found in red meat, as with all other animal products, is considered a complete protein source. This means that it provides our bodies with all the essential amino acids in the right amounts
